KARACHI: Tension at SMC

By Our Staff Reporter


KARACHI, April 11: In view of the tension prevailing at the Sindh Medical College, its administration has decided to call the parents of the students, who were nominated in an FIR after April 2 brawl at the college campus.

Sources said that a meeting of the faculty was held on Saturday to review the situation emerging in the wake of April 2 violence. It was decided that the parents of about 20 students, allegedly involved in the brawl, would be invited on April 17, to be informed about the conduct of the students and their alleged indulgence in violent activities.

Sources said that viva voce of third and fourth year MBBS exams would be held from April 12, as per revised schedule. The candidates having admit cards would be allowed entry into the college.

About classes, it was learnt that the administration would assess the situation for another couple of days and resumption of classes on April 12 was unlikely.
